Aristocratic heritage: Steeped in over 400 years of history, Schloss & Boutiquehotel Mitterhart offers a unique blend of noble tradition and modern flair. Originally built in 1615, this grand estate has been lovingly preserved by the Mair family for six generations. You’ll find a seamless transition from the main castle’s wood-panelled stüberls to the sleek, newly renovated rooms.

Tirolean culinary world: Experience the authentic flavours of the Alps at the hotel’s restaurant, a proud member of the Tiroler Wirtshaus association. Settle into the atmospheric vaulted dining room or the rustic Gwercher Stube for a menu of seasonal specialities and traditional Sunday roasts. As evening falls, enjoy a crisp local wine in the bar or out in the blooming castle gardens.

Award-winning greenery: Surround yourself with natural beauty in the hotel’s gardens, recently named among the top 10 most beautiful terraces and gardens in Tyrol by Falstaff. These verdant grounds offer a peaceful sanctuary with views of the River Inn and the towering peaks of the local mountains. It is the perfect spot for a lazy afternoon coffee or a sunset apéritif under the shade of ancient trees.
How to get thereThe hotel is located in Vomp, approximately 30 minutes from Innsbruck Airport by car. For those arriving by rail, Jenbach station is a major transport hub nearby, and the hotel is also conveniently connected to local public transport routes. We'd recommend hiring a car in order to get the most out of the beautiful area.
